Northampton students press school leaders over bathroom closures, hall‑monitor enforcement

Northampton School Committee · February 12, 2026
AI-Generated Content: All content on this page was generated by AI to highlight key points from the meeting. For complete details and context, we recommend watching the full video. so we can fix them.

Summary

Student Advisory Council members told the School Committee they regularly face closed bathrooms, vandalism, vaping and inconsistent hall‑monitor enforcement at Northampton High School and asked to be consulted on solutions. School leaders described new hall‑monitor hires and a SmartPass pilot to address the problems.

Student leaders told the Northampton School Committee on Feb. 12 that repeated bathroom closures at Northampton High School — caused by vandalism, vaping and safety incidents — are affecting daily life and learning.

“Sometimes all of the bathrooms are closed… and that is preposterous,” said student commentator Zara during the Student Advisory Council presentation, describing clogged toilets, burn marks and fights that have led to prolonged closures. Students said hall monitors often fail to enforce sign‑in procedures, allow groups to enter together and use personal devices while on duty, undermining the stated purpose of monitoring.
